ascastil Posted December 13, 2015 Share Posted December 13, 2015 Racetronix hotwire fuel pump kit. Pretty common. Its just an upgrade from the small gauge wire from the factory to the pump. Ive used it on my LT1 Camaro and my C5 currently. It provides more voltage to the pump.http://www.racetronix.biz/itemdesc.asp?ic=FPWH-008&eq=&Tp=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Unreal Posted December 13, 2015 Share Posted December 13, 2015 Only helps if you are running out of fuel, and very borderline. Otherwise a waste of money. Stock fuel pump is more than enough for any bolt ons/heads/cam/etc without touching anything.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
joe@cpr.com Posted December 15, 2015 Share Posted December 15, 2015 smart move if you are doing an aftermarket pump but not needed at all for bolt on, cam, etc guys. Vette's are fine, fbody's need this big time though.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
